Tenderfoot TV, iHP Launch Genre-Bending Series Wisecrack

Tenderfoot TV and iHeartPodcasts have unveiled Wisecrack, a new six-part limited series that fuses stand-up comedy with true crime storytelling. The series debuts September 2 with episodes released weekly on iHeartRadio and all major podcast platforms. Subscribers to Tenderfoot+ will be able to binge the entire season ad-free on launch day.

At the heart of Wisecrack is comedian Edd Hedges, whose stage act unexpectedly transforms into a harrowing true story about the deadliest night in his small English village. On July 22, 2015, Hedges returned home for a charity performance, only to find the evening descending into terror when a murderer began claiming lives hours after his set. The ordeal became personal when the killer came to his doorstep.

Through a mix of self-deprecating humor and vivid storytelling, Hedges revisits the trauma of that night while painting a portrait of the people and places that shaped him. His material-ranging from tales about his father with eight fingers to his mother's accidental entanglement with meth dealing-threads through the series as both comic relief and a narrative device.

The project originated after Emmy-nominated crime producer Jodi Tovay saw Hedges' act at the Edinburgh Fringe Festival. "The moment I heard his set, it stopped me in my tracks," said Tovay, who serves as host and producer. "My curiosity took over and I left vacation early and got to work, knowing that everyone needed to hear this immediately."

The investigation spans from Hedges' English village to the courtroom and prison, before circling back to the stage where his story began. "I tried to deal with the trauma of that night through comedy, but I wasn't willing to fully drop my guard," said Hedges. "This podcast faces it all, head-on."

Donald Albright, co-founder and CEO of Tenderfoot TV, called the series unlike anything podcast audiences have heard before. "When you think you have heard every type of true crime story, Wisecrack proves you haven't. Comedy and crime are a proven recipe for success, but Wisecrack uses the art of stand-up comedy as a device to tell a narrative story, where every punchline hides something darker."

Co-produced with Starwipe Productions, Wisecrack is distributed by iHeartPodcasts.
